What is a Karaoke Bar?


A Karaoke Bar is a venue where patrons get on stage and perform karaoke tracks, usually with the backing music but without the original vocals.
Whether you're singing solo or with a group of friends, Karaoke Bars offer a relaxed environment for everyone to express themselves musically.

Karaoke Bars Around the World


Originating in Asia, karaoke is now beloved globally. In the U.S., karaoke bars are social hotspots with open-mic stages.

Unique Regional Experiences



  • Japan: Tech-driven karaoke boxes with drink delivery buttons

  • Often integrated with happy hours and drink specials

  • South Korea: Luxurious karaoke rooms and 24/7 access

  • Philippines: Karaoke is a cultural staple, even in homes
